Alright, let's dive into Chapter 7: Incursion! This map can be a bit tricky with its narrow paths, so we'll want to play it smart from the get-go.

Boss Information:

  • Name: Vasto
  • Class: Wyvern Rider
  • Level: 12
  • Item: Steel Axe

New Units:

  • Name: Cordelia
  • Class: Pegasus Knight
  • Level: 7
  • Recruitment: Joins from Turn 3
Walkthrough
  1. 1
    Initial Defense: When you start, the enemies will come to you. This is your chance to set up a strong defensive line. Put your sturdiest units at the front to take the hits, and position your mages or archers behind them so they can attack safely. The narrow terrain actually works in your favor here, funneling the enemies.
  2. 2
    Watch the Skies: Keep a close eye on the Wyvern Riders positioned on the mountains and cliffs. They have a good range and can easily pick off your weaker units like healers if you're not careful. Try to keep them engaged or out of their attack range.
  3. 3
    Pushing Right: After you've dealt with the first wave of enemies, it's time to start advancing. Your goal is to move towards the right side of the map. This is important because enemy reinforcements will start appearing from the left, the same side where Cordelia will eventually show up.
  4. 4
    Reinforcements and Cordelia: Around turns 4-6, you'll likely be facing new enemies coming from the left. This is also when Cordelia, a valuable Pegasus Knight, will join your cause. Make sure you're ready to handle the new threats while also securing Cordelia's recruitment.
  5. 5
    Securing the Middle: By the time you've dealt with the reinforcements and Cordelia has joined, you should aim to have the middle of the map under control. This gives you a good staging ground for the final push.
  6. 6
    Facing the Boss: The boss, Vasto, can be dealt with relatively easily. If you have Chrom, his Falchion weapon is super effective against him. Just remember to keep an eye on enemy ranges as you approach and proceed with caution. Don't rush in blindly!
